Neurodevelopmental Disorders in DSM-5

  • Autism Spectrum Disorder is a neurodevelopmental disorder recognized in the DSM-5, characterized by persistent difficulties with social communication and interaction, as well as restricted and repetitive patterns of behavior, interests, or activities.
  •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ental disorder recognized in the DSM-5, characterized by persistent difficulties with attention, impulsivity, and hyperactivity.
  • Specific Learning Disorder is a neurodevelopmental disorder recognized in the DSM-5, characterized by significant difficulties in reading, writing, or mathematics skills.
  • Intellectual Disability (formerly Mental Retardation) is a neurodevelopmental disorder recognized in the DSM-5, characterized by deficits in intellectual functioning and adaptive functioning.
